Key Fob Lost

Car key fobs can be quite complicated. While they might look like regular keys, they contain devices that can communicate with sensors inside your Lexus and allow you to lock and unlock the doors as well as start the ignition using a push button. Because of this they can be very sensitive and require special attention when it comes to handling and maintenance.

Parent Logic claims that this is the norm when you lose your lexus is200 key key fob. However, this isn't always the scenario, and you may get into a little trouble if you don't have an extra set.

The good news is that a brand new key can be quite affordable to replace. In most cases, you'll be in a position to buy one from a dealer or a locksmith for your car. You can also purchase a key fob online at a variety of shops. Choose a brand that has transponder keys compatible with your specific model.

Finding a Lexus key fob repaired should be relatively straightforward and affordable however, the exact price will depend on what kind of key you used, where you purchased it, and how much programming is required to integrate it with your vehicle. Smart push-to-start key fobs, for instance, can be more costly than conventional ones since they require programming to unlock your vehicle and enable the remote starter feature.

Lost Ignition Key

You may be able get a new key from your dealer if your car has an advanced key that has an embedded chip. To receive a new key, you'll need to prove ownership. They will also need to connect the chip electronically to your vehicle. This process can take several days to complete.

The first thing you need to do is to check thoroughly for your keys in the car as well as around the house. They can be easily hidden under carpeting, under mats or even under the seat cushions. If you still can't locate them, you should upgrade your search tools with a powerful flashlight and an inspection mirror that is small, and also an iron or plastic ruler.

If you lose your key code, you'll need to contact your dealer or manufacturer for an exact copy. The key code makes it possible to programme a new keys to your vehicle so that it is recognizable by the ECU (Electronic Control Unit). You may be able reset the key on your own if you follow the instructions in the owner's manual. It usually involves pressing a series of buttons in a sequential manner however this may vary from model to model. A locksmith can also reprogramme a new key to your vehicle but the process will cost more.

Keyless Entry Keys Lost

The key fob on a Lexus is a smart device that enables you to open and start the car remotely. They can also be difficult to find, especially when they're kept in your purse or pocket. If you've lost one, try retracing your steps or checking places they are usually set. If you're unable to locate them, a locksmith for your car or dealer may be able to provide the replacement.

The cost of replacing a Lexus key fob depends on the type of key you had (if it was an intelligent key, "push to start" car key, or regular metal key). The year of the vehicle is also crucial since some keys require coding while others don't. Certain key fobs are cut with a simple machine, while those which use RFID technology will have to be programmed by an auto locksmith or a dealer.

Some locksmiths offer on-site service and can cut and program your key directly on site. However, it's always recommended to contact them first to verify that they have the right equipment and will be able to help in your particular circumstance. They could save you the cost and stress of having to take your vehicle to the dealership. They may charge a little more but it's less than what you would pay at the dealership.
